Management of Pharyngitis
Diagnostic Approach: Laboratory Confirmation is Essential
Clinical diagnosis alone is unreliable—laboratory confirmation with rapid antigen detection test (RADT) or throat culture is required because signs and symptoms of Group A Streptococcal (GAS) and viral pharyngitis overlap too broadly for accurate clinical differentiation. 1
Testing Algorithm by Age Group
- Adults: Perform RADT in patients with clinical features suggesting bacterial infection; a negative RADT is sufficient to rule out streptococcal pharyngitis without confirmatory culture 2
- Children: Confirm all negative RADTs with throat culture due to higher GAS prevalence and rheumatic fever risk 2
- Children under 3 years: Do not routinely test, as GAS pharyngitis and rheumatic fever are rare in this age group 2
Clinical Features Suggesting GAS Testing
- Sudden onset of sore throat with fever 3
- Tender anterior cervical lymphadenopathy 4
- Tonsillar exudates 4
- Absence of cough and nasal symptoms 4, 3
- Patient age 5-15 years 4
Treatment of Confirmed GAS Pharyngitis
For patients without penicillin allergy, oral penicillin V or amoxicillin for 10 days is the standard of care and remains the drug of choice due to proven efficacy, narrow spectrum, safety, and low cost—with no documented penicillin resistance in GAS anywhere in the world. 2, 5
First-Line Treatment (No Penicillin Allergy)
- Amoxicillin: 50 mg/kg/day once daily (maximum 1000 mg) for 10 days—offers improved adherence with once-daily dosing 2
- Penicillin V: Standard dosing for 10 days 2, 6
- Intramuscular benzathine penicillin G: Single dose (600,000 U for <27 kg; 1,200,000 U for ≥27 kg) for patients unlikely to complete oral therapy 2
Penicillin-Allergic Patients: Treatment Algorithm
For non-anaphylactic penicillin allergy (delayed rash, non-severe reactions):
- First-generation cephalosporins (cephalexin 500 mg twice daily or cefadroxil 1000 mg once daily) for 10 days—cross-reactivity risk is only 0.1% in non-severe reactions 2, 5
For immediate/anaphylactic penicillin allergy (anaphylaxis, angioedema, urticaria within 1 hour):
- Clindamycin 300 mg three times daily (7 mg/kg/dose in children, max 300 mg) for 10 days—preferred choice with only 1% resistance rate in the United States 2, 5
- Azithromycin 500 mg day 1, then 250 mg days 2-5 (12 mg/kg once daily in children, max 500 mg)—only requires 5 days but has 5-8% resistance rate 2, 5
- Clarithromycin 250 mg twice daily for 10 days 2
Critical Treatment Duration
A full 10-day course is essential for all antibiotics except azithromycin to achieve maximal pharyngeal eradication and prevent acute rheumatic fever—shortening the course by even a few days dramatically increases treatment failure rates. 2, 5
Treatment of Viral (Strep-Negative) Pharyngitis
Withhold antibiotics entirely for patients with negative GAS testing—antimicrobial therapy is of no proven benefit for viral pharyngitis. 1, 2
Symptomatic Management
- NSAIDs (ibuprofen): Provide superior pain relief compared to acetaminophen for moderate to severe symptoms or high fever 2, 4
- Acetaminophen: Alternative for pain and fever control 2
- Warm salt water gargles: Can provide symptomatic relief 2
- Medicated throat lozenges: Used every 2 hours are effective 4
- Avoid aspirin in children: Risk of Reye syndrome 2
Do not use corticosteroids as adjunctive therapy—they provide only minimal benefit (approximately 5 hours pain reduction) with potential adverse effects. 1, 2
Common Pitfalls to Avoid
- Never treat based on clinical symptoms alone without laboratory confirmation—this leads to massive antibiotic overuse 2
- Do not use these antibiotics for GAS pharyngitis: Tetracyclines (high resistance), sulfonamides, trimethoprim-sulfamethoxazole (do not eradicate GAS), or ciprofloxacin (limited GAS activity) 2, 7
- Do not perform routine follow-up throat cultures after completing therapy in asymptomatic patients 1, 2
- Do not test or treat asymptomatic household contacts 1, 2
- Do not use cephalosporins in patients with immediate/anaphylactic penicillin reactions—up to 10% cross-reactivity risk 1, 5
- Do not prescribe shorter courses than recommended (except azithromycin's 5-day regimen)—this increases treatment failure and rheumatic fever risk 2, 5
Special Circumstances: Recurrent or Persistent Pharyngitis
If Symptoms Persist After Completing Therapy
Consider that the patient may be a chronic GAS carrier experiencing intercurrent viral infections rather than true recurrent GAS pharyngitis—obtain repeat throat culture or RADT to determine if GAS is still present. 1, 2
Treatment Failure (Positive Culture After Completing Penicillin)
- Clindamycin 300 mg three times daily for 10 days—preferred for treatment failure with approximately 1% resistance 2, 7
- Amoxicillin-clavulanate 875 mg twice daily for 10 days—addresses beta-lactamase-producing co-pathogens 2, 7
- Intramuscular benzathine penicillin G if oral compliance is questionable 1, 2
Chronic GAS Carriers
Do not routinely identify or treat chronic GAS carriers—they are at little risk for complications or spreading infection and do not ordinarily require antimicrobial therapy. 1, 2
Treatment of carriers is justified only in special circumstances: community outbreak of rheumatic fever, family history of rheumatic fever, or excessive family anxiety 2
Key Clinical Points
- Patients become non-contagious after 24 hours of appropriate antibiotic therapy 2
- Primary goal of treatment is preventing acute rheumatic fever, not just symptom relief—this requires adequate bacterial eradication 1, 2
- Group C and Group G streptococcal pharyngitis do not cause rheumatic fever and do not require the same treatment approach 2
- Therapy can be safely postponed up to 9 days after symptom onset and still prevent acute rheumatic fever 5
